The Electric Mountain is a “pumped storage facility”. The Tennessee Valley Authority built one at Raccoon Mountain. It went online in 1978.

It’s purpose is to supply electricity during peak hours and recharge itself using electricity from elsewhere during off-peak hours.

It’s primary value is that it can be stopped and started quickly which allows the baseload plants such as coal-fired and nuclear steam to not have to be started and stopped often.

Starting and stopping the steam plants shortens their lifetimes because of expansion and contraction of the steam pipes which leads to cracking and fatigue.

A pumped storage facility is a net user of electricity rather than a producer. Why? Because it takes more energy to pump the water up than is produced when the water comes down through the turbines. It’s like a battery.
